Output 43df786bea95fd651e13babcee4a60266c7c8722da8ea18115ee5bed2c872ffe:0

value
1285690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f8435a10fb6afc0e56052a5740a5d4d1f0438d OP_EQUAL
address
3MZXxnx8RpCknUmzqFCzwepGMjBpdeZ8rt
transaction
43df786bea95fd651e13babcee4a60266c7c8722da8ea18115ee5bed2c872ffe
confirmations
1984
spent
true